Custom Home Building: A Step-by-Step Guide

Creating a custom home is an exciting journey that begins with meticulous planning and informed decision-making. The first step involves establishing a budget, which will direct all future choices. Next, picking a suitable lot is crucial, as location can affect architectural plans and livability. Once the site is obtained, homeowners should create a detailed wish list that specifies essential features and amenities.

Subsequently, working with an architect or designer to develop initial plans aids in envisioning the project. Once finalizing the design, acquiring necessary permits and approvals is vital before construction begins.

When construction starts, regular communication with the builder confirms that the project continues according to plan. Homeowners should set up routine site visits to observe progress and handle any concerns. Finally, once the home is complete, a detailed walk-through checks that all specifications are met, resulting in the exciting moment of moving into a newly crafted space.

How to Pick the Right Custom Home Builder for Your Construction Project

What's the best way for homeowners guarantee they select the right custom home builder for their project? First, they should carry out thorough research by requesting recommendations from family, friends, and internet reviews. A shortlist of potential builders can be assembled based on this feedback. Next, homeowners should confirm credentials, making sure that the builders are licensed, insured, and have relevant experience in custom home construction.

Scheduling interviews with each builder helps homeowners to determine compatibility and communication styles. During these discussions, discussing their vision and seeking past project examples can provide insight into the builder's capabilities. Furthermore, obtaining detailed quotes helps homeowners analyze pricing and transparency.

Lastly, checking references and visiting previous projects can strengthen the decision-making process. By executing these steps, homeowners can assuredly select a custom home builder who fits their vision and project requirements, securing a rewarding building experience.

What Is the Typical Duration of the Custom Home Building Process?

What Are the Financing Choices for Custom Home Construction?

Funding choices for building a custom home include personal loans, traditional mortgages, and construction loans. Prospective homeowners may also investigate government programs or lines of credit, each providing different terms and conditions tailored to individual needs.

Can Modifications Be Made During the Construction Process?

Modifications are often possible during the construction phase, but they could lead to additional expenses and timeline extensions. It's crucial to communicate with the builder to understand the implications and feasibility of requested modifications.

What Permits Are Required for Building a Custom Home?

Building a custom home typically requires different permits, including zoning permits, building permits, electrical and plumbing permits, and perhaps environmental assessments. Each locality may have particular requirements, demanding comprehensive research and collaboration with local authorities.

How Can I Handle Unexpected Costs During the Building Process?

To address unexpected costs during the building process, you should maintain a contingency budget, communicate regularly with the builder, and review contracts thoroughly. This proactive approach serves to lessen financial surprises and promotes smoother project progression.
